Planning your visit
Enjoying Place Masséna’s charm begins with some smart planning. The square attracts visitors year-round, with peak energy during festivals and warm months. It sits at the heart of Nice, well connected to major transit lines but also well loved, so expect company—especially in summer. Most activities here are open and free to all. No tickets required, and lots to explore for every age and interest.
- Best time to visit: Early morning for quiet moments, or late afternoon when the sunlight warms the colored facades. Spring and autumn see fewer crowds.
- How to get there: Take Tram Line 1, which stops right at Place Masséna. The plaza is a short walk from Nice-Ville train station and an easy stroll from the Promenade des Anglais.
- Accessibility: Wide flat surfaces make it suitable for strollers and wheelchairs. Benches and cafes provide rest stops for all ages.
- Average visit duration: Most visitors enjoy the area for 1-2 hours, but with cafes and shopping, some stay longer.
